Information About Local Measure CC

On November 5, 2024, voters passed Measure CC – the Riverside Community College District Career Preparation, Affordable Higher Education Measure.

Measure CC is a $954M community investment that will fund:

  • New facilities at Moreno Valley College (including the Ben Clark Training Center), Norco College, and Riverside City College
  • Renovation and/or demolition of RCCD’s oldest buildings that will result in the removal of asbestos, mold and lead paint; upgrades to outdated electrical wiring, gas and sewer lines; repairs to leaky roofs; and improvements in earthquake safety
  • New RCCD facilities in Corona and Jurupa Valley
  • Upgrades to modernize classrooms and labs
  • Local projects, and allow the District to pursue matching state funding
